It seems to be using the thermostat's presets for your apps mode change. Meaning whenever the app sends command to change to heat, cool, auto it will use the numbers from the comfort settings heat and cool setpoints. Not sure if I explained that well enough

This is what the thermostat does ALWAYS - it gets its setpoints from the currently select comfort setting. When you change setpoints, you should be changing the ones for the selected comfort setting.

Hello, does the ESM work with the Ecobee SmartBuildings accounts? I installed ESM and when linking the API there is an option for a Commercial account which I thought would be SmartBuildings since it is meant for Commercial and and supports the EMS Ecobee products according to Ecobee documentation. When I try selecting Commercial as the account type and then try to authenticate it won't accept my SmartBuildings login. I also don't know what the field is needing that asks for the path of the desired Management Set.

Edit: Looking around on Ecobee's site I see references to a commercial app that doesn't seem to exist anymore so I'm thinking Ecobee had something different before SmartBuildings which is a completely different platform that the prior Commercial account.
If the ESM could be updated to link into Ecobee's SmartBuildings platform that would be wonderful. The company I work for uses Ecobee's as well as Hubitat and I would like to be able to use them together.

Sorry, no ESM does not support SmartBuildings; and yes, it supports the older (defunct?) Commercial accounts.

SmartBuildings uses a completely different API, and I’m not up for a total rewrite for something that I can’t/won’t ever be able to use (I am retired).

You might reach out to the “other” community developed (for profit) Ecobee integration to see if the author has already done the work, or is interested in doing so.

It's an Ecobee API server issue. Most instances of Ecobee Suite will automatically recover, but some people may need to re-authenticate to get things running again.

FWIW, both of my installations where impacted. One recovered on its own at 4:24pm EDT; the other recovered at 4:27pm.

I expect that users of the native Ecobee support provided by Hubitat (and SmartThings) will not automatically recover, as their implementations are not as robust about re-trying failed connections.
